This book arose from a blog set-up by the author, who is a professional Archaeologist working in Ireland, to generate interest and research into the emigrant experience of the Irish in nineteenth century America. Over a period of 3 years he has provided detailed information on such diverse topics as Irish born recipients of the Medal of Honour ,list of Irish Generals on both sides of the conflict and the post-war occupations of the Civil War survivors. This book elaborates on these blogs backed up by the latest research in both America and Ireland to summarise the experience of Irish emigrants who fought and died in both Blue and Grey uniforms and who distinguished themselves by bravery on the battlefields- e.g. the Irish Brigade at both Fredericksburg , Antietam and the Wheatfield at Gettysburg. Indeed the book recollects the visit of President Kennedy to Ireland in June 1963 ,when in an address to the Irish Parliament , he presented to the Irish Nation a colour flag of the 69th New York Infantry ,in recognition of those gallant Irishmen and what they had done for America. The book is a wonderful read and by illustrating key events of the Civil War through the words of individual participants , he succeeds in bringing the Civil War to life.
